Annalisa Batista-Ferreira

Sr, Director, Global Brand Marketing, Building Sets at Mattel

Annalisa Batista-Ferreira has over a decade of experience in global brand marketing, currently serving as Sr. Director of Global Brand Marketing for Building Sets and Sr. Director of Barbie Global Brand Marketing at Mattel, Inc. since June 2014. Prior to their tenure at Mattel, Annalisa held the position of Brand Manager for Kids & Collector Brands at Mega Brands from October 2008 to June 2014 and worked as a Coordinator in Device Marketing at Fido Solutions from 2006 to 2008. Annalisa's educational background includes a Graduate Certificate in Public Relations, Advertising, and Applied Communication from McGill University, a Bachelor of Commerce in Marketing from Concordia University, and a D.E.C in Creative Arts, Communications, and Cinema from Dawson College.

Mattel is a leading global toy company and owner of one of the strongest catalogs of children’s and family entertainment franchises in the world. They create innovative products and experiences that inspire, entertain and develop children through play. They engage consumers through their portfolio of iconic brands, including Barbie®, Hot Wheels®, Fisher-Price®, American Girl®, Thomas & Friends®, UNO® and MEGA®, as well as other popular intellectual properties that we own or license in partnership with global entertainment companies. Their offerings include film and television content, gaming, music and live events. They operate in 35 locations and their products are available in more than 150 countries in collaboration with the world’s leading retail and ecommerce companies. Since its founding in 1945, Mattel is proud to be a trusted partner in empowering children to explore the wonder of childhood and reach their full potential.
